Violence against women in the final report of the Colombian Truth Commission: perspectives from the Latin American experience

Diana Marcela Gómez Correal, lecturer at CIDER, Interdisciplinary Centre for Development Studies (Universidad de los Andes, Bogotá), will give a lecture on Wednesday 7 June from 16:00 to 18:00 in the Salón de Grados of Zubiria Etxea (Hegoa, Campus of Sarriko, UPV/EHU) entitled "Las violencias contra las mujeres en el informe final de la Comisión de la Verdad de Colombia: miradas situadas en la experiencia latinoamericana" (Violence against women in the final report of the Colombian Truth Commission: perspectives from the Latin American experience).

The talk will address the main contributions of the Final Report of the Colombian Truth Commission to the clarification of violence against women, as well as some of its gaps from a decolonial feminist lens of transitional justice. The Colombian experience will be framed within the development of other truth commissions, as well as the slow but interesting incorporation of such violence and the gender perspective in their work.
